广西贵港市2016高考英语七选五类摸底选练(5)信息匹配(共5小题;每小题2分,满分10分) 下面是一篇应用文及其应用场合的信息,请阅读下列应用文和相关信息,并按照要求匹配信息。请在答题卡上将对应题号的相应选项字母涂黑。 以下是招聘公司的信息。a. placements impact ltd.two full-time accountants are needed: male / female. we offer contract, consulting and direct hire positions for talented individuals. once employed, you will be responsible for coordinating and synthesizing(合成) financial and management data to interpret the composite financial results of operations as well as reviewing, analyzing, evaluating, and reporting upon program accomplishments in financial terms. contact us: placementsimpact tom. comb. canadian recruiting firmwe are presently looking for many motivated candidates for our north-american corporateclients in the marketing / management area: marketing managers, and assistant managers and marketing consultants. our practice areas include: marketing / sales, export / internationalbusiness and management / finance area. contact us: recruitingfirm sina. comc. recruits pain lit. companyour client, a long and most established project management company, specializing in delivering residential, hotel and golf resort projects on time and to the highest standards, is looking forproject managers. requirements: minimum 2 years proven experience in similar positions; fluent in written and spoken spanish, english and / or french. contact us: recruitspain hotmail. comd. hays agan sap basis administrator / consultant is needed. the consultant should take over the bw & apo system for bw (3.1, 3.5), apo (4.0, 5.1) and r / 3 systems (4.6b, ecc6.0). the task includes the daily monitoring of sap systems and the analyzing of general performance issues. german and english must be very good. contact us: haysag 163. come. iqm selezione s.r.l.an oil & gas engineer is needed: male / female. an international process engineering company,with over 3-5 years experience in designing and implementing plants for the chemical, petrochemical and refining (石油炼制) industries, is looking for an oil & gas engineer. contact us: iqm seleznesrl. comf. systelincjob title: oracle applications crm. this position requires german speaking skills and the person/employee needs to have a visa status which allows him to work locally. i would really appreciate it if you are able to source some potential candidates for this project. skills required: over four years in crm. contact us: oraclecrm sina. com 以下是求职者的信息。请匹配求职者与他们所拟定的公司。46. jenna is a university professor in london, who has 5 years experience in the role, previously working in the oil and gas plant industry. she also has experience in reinforced concrete and metal structural calculation. she can speak fluent italian.47. nenny can demonstrate technical proficiency and experience in coordinating and synthesizing financial and management data, and possesses a desire to deliver exceptional client service. she is an experienced financial analyst and accountant.48. richard from germany has been working on crm modules since 1990. he is also good at studied electronics, programming, etc. and is very happy to live and work in sydney, australia. he has a visa status to allow him to work locally.49. paul thompson speaks english and german well. he has prior professional experience in bw & apo systems. coordination, reporting and abap skills are part of his abilities. he has a good knowledge of sap, performance optimization, workbenches and abap.50. david lee has a knowledge of the marketing management area. he has an understanding of marketing consultants. he is good at project management, interpersonal communication etc. he is able to work independently and in a team situation. he speaks english very well.【参考答案】46-50 eafdb【湖南省怀化市2014高考英语3月一模试题】section b (10 marks)directions: read the following passage. answer the questions according to the information given in the passage. we lived in a very quiet neighborhood. one evening i heard a loud crash in the street. earlier that evening my wife had asked me to go to the store to get some soft drinks. it seemed like this would be a good time to let my teenager daughter holly practice her driving. at dinner my son talked about how much he liked my truck. i enjoyed having it, but i said, “guy, my heart is not set on that truck. i like it but it is just metal and wont last forever. never set your heart on anything that wont last.” after hearing the loud noise, the whole family ran outside. my son shouted, “dad! dad, holly crashed your truck.” my heart sank and my mind was flooded with conflicting thoughts. was anyone hurt? who else was involved? as i ran to the door, i heard a voice in my heart say, “here is a chance to show holly what you really love. shell never forget it.” the accident had occurred in my own driveway. holly had crashed my truck into our other vehicle, the family van (搬运车). in her inexperience, she had confused the brakes and the gas pedal. holly was unhurt physically, but when i reached her, she was crying and saying, “oh, dad, im sorry. i know how much you love this truck.” i held her in my arms as she cried. later that week a friend stopped by and asked what had happened to my truck. i told her the story. her eyes moistened(湿润) and she said, “that happened to me when i was a girl. i borrowed my dads car and ran into a log that had fallen across the road. i ruined the car. when i got home my dad knocked me to the ground and began to kick me.” over 40 years later, she still felt the pain of that night. it was a deep wound on her soul. i remember how sad holly was the night and how i comforted her. one day, when holly thinks back on her life, i want her to know that i love her a thousand times more than any piece of property. i repaired the van, but the dent (凹痕) in my truck is still there today. every day it reminds me of what really matters in my life.81. why did the father permit his daughter to drive his truck? (no more than 5 words) (2 marks) 82. how did the accident happen? (no more than 11 words) (3 marks) 83. what happened to the authors friend after she ruined her dads car? (no more than 11 words) (2 marks) 84. what does the writer try to tell us according to the passage? (no more than 10 words) (3 marks) 【参考答案】81. to practice her driving. 82. holly had confused the brakes and the gas pedal. /holly stepped on the gas pedal instead of the brakes. / holly mistook the gad pedal for the brakes.83. her father knocked her to the ground and kicked her. / her father was violent toward her. 84. that love is more important than possessions/any piece of property./ family members really matter in his life.【甘肃省嘉峪关市一中2014模拟】情景对话(共5小题,每小题2分,满分10分)根据短文内容,从下面ag选项中选出能填入空白处的最佳选项,并在答题卡上将该选项涂黑。选项中有二项为多余项。 culture shock culture shock refers to the anxiety and feelings (of surprise, uncertainty, confusion, etc.) felt when people have to operate within a different and unknown cultural or social environment, such as a foreign country.generally speaking, we could say that there are four stages of culture shock. the first stage is called “the honeymoon”. in this stage, you are excited about living in a different place. 16 the next stage is “the hostility(敌意)stage”. in this stage, you begin to notice not everything is as good as you originally thought it was. 17 moreover, people dont treat you like a guest anymore. then you come to the third stage called “recovery”. in this stage, you start to feel more positive. 18 the whole situation starts to become more favorable and you begin to learn to adapt yourself to it. the last stage of culture shock is called “adjustment”. in this stage, you have reached a point where you actually feel good. 19 the things that originally made you feel uncomfortable or strange are now things that you understand. now you have adjusted to the new culture and you feel comfortable. not all individuals visiting another country will experience all these four stages. 20 it also occurs within cultures as individuals move from place to place or from one setting to another (e.g., from high school to college). a. you feel that friends should help each other to deal with culture shock. b. and you try to develop comprehension of everything you dont understand.c. in addition, culture shock is not limited to the overseas visitor.d. you become tired of many things about the new culture. e. you have learned enough to understand the new culture.f. you begin to understand you need to travel a lot.g. and everything seems to be marvelous and everybody seems to be so nice to you. 16.g17.d18.b19.e20.c【上海市长宁、嘉定区2014模拟】任务型阅读 directions: read the passage carefully. then answer the questions or complete the statements in the fewest possible words. for decades, a small percentage of homeowners have been installing solar panels (嵌板) on their rooftops. those panels collect solar energy and change it into electricity. until recently, the panels were too expensive for average homeowners, and their designs were anything but appealing. thanks to new advances, however, solar panels for homes are becoming cheaper and less awkward, causing more homeowners to consider installing them.last fall furniture seller ikea began selling solar panels in its u.k. stores. of course, home improvement stores such as home depot have been selling panels for a while. but the initiative by ikea is seen as a way to bring the do it yourself solar option to the masses. while shopping for inexpensive furniture, shoppers could add a box or two of solar panels to their carts. ikea is partnering with a company that handles installation and servicing of the panels, making the switch to solar easy for customers. if all goes well, ikea plans to begin selling the panels in other countries soon.soltech, a swedish tech company, offers a solar-power solution that is much more pleasing to the eye than traditional solar panels. instead of flat panels, soltech offers a glass tile (瓦片) solution that goes well with existing tiled roof designs. the see-through tiles have a silver-gray color to them, and their shape fits traditional tiled roof designs. soltech currently offers the solar systems that heat the homes air or water and one solar pv system that produces electricity. new energy technologies, inc. is developing a solar application that wont be installed on rooftops. instead, the first-of-its-kind solarwindowtm technology enables see-through windows to produce electricity in the way of showering their glass surfaces with the companys patent-pending (专利申请中的) electricity-producing coatings. amazingly, solarwindowtm can produce electricity in low-light conditions and can even turn indoor light into electricity!
